Highland Park is a vibrant North Shore community located along the shores of Lake Michigan, known for its beautiful lakefront, historic architecture, and lively cultural scene. The city features a charming downtown filled with shops, restaurants, and galleries, as well as scenic parks and beaches that offer stunning views of the lake. Highland Park is also home to the renowned Ravinia Festival, the oldest outdoor music festival in the United States, attracting world-class performers each summer. With its mix of natural beauty, arts, and community events, Highland Park offers a dynamic yet welcoming atmosphere just north of Chicago
Glencoe is a beautiful North Shore village nestled along Lake Michigan, known for its blend of natural landscapes, historic homes, and cultural attractions. The community features scenic beaches, wooded neighborhoods, and easy access to outdoor recreation along the lake and nearby forest preserves. Glencoe is also home to the renowned Chicago Botanic Garden, a world-class destination featuring stunning gardens, walking trails, and seasonal events. With its quiet residential charm, strong community atmosphere, and proximity to Chicago, Glencoe offers a peaceful yet vibrant place to live and visit.

Lisle is a welcoming western suburb of Chicago known for its natural beauty, vibrant community, and convenient location along the I-88 corridor. Often called the “Arboretum Village,” Lisle is home to the renowned The Morton Arboretum, a sprawling outdoor museum featuring miles of scenic trails, gardens, and seasonal events. The village offers a mix of residential neighborhoods, parks, and a growing downtown area, along with easy access to Metra commuter rail service into Chicago. With its blend of green space, community events, and suburban convenience, Lisle provides a balanced and welcoming place to live and visit.

Grand Haven is a lively lakeshore town on the eastern shore of Lake Michigan, known for its beautiful sandy beaches, historic lighthouse, and scenic waterfront. Visitors are drawn to the iconic Grand Haven Pier and Lighthouse, the bustling boardwalk along the Grand River, and the popular Musical Fountain that lights up summer evenings. With a charming downtown filled with local shops and restaurants, plus easy access to boating, fishing, and beach activities, Grand Haven is a favorite destination for classic Lake Michigan vacations.
South Haven is a picturesque harbor town on the shores of Lake Michigan, known for its sandy beaches, historic lighthouse, and charming marina. Often called the “Blueberry Capital of the World,” South Haven is famous for its summer blueberry harvests, local farms, and farmers markets. Visitors enjoy strolling the walkable downtown filled with shops, restaurants, and galleries, as well as boating, beach days, and sunsets along the scenic pier. With its relaxed coastal vibe and classic lakefront charm, South Haven is a beloved destination for Midwest getaways
